Deploy step 4 — ProctorQueue (Harkwell Assessments)

Provision the queue worker with least-privilege IAM. Set QUEUE_VISIBILITY_TIMEOUT=120 and PROCTOR_MAX_SESSIONS=40. Confirm TLS is enforced on the broker endpoint; reject plaintext fallback. Audit logs must ship before the worker accepts sessions. The broker connection authenticates with a credential defined on the next line.

env line for fafof-fahag: LEDGER_TOKEN5=f8790

14:22 — Offline sync regression confirmed (Terrapath field-survey app)

At 14:22 the on-call engineer reproduced the data-loss path: surveys saved while offline were marked synced once connectivity returned, even when the upload was rejected. The queue flush skipped the server acknowledgement check introduced in the previous sprint. Release manager note: the fix must ship before the coastal survey season. The offending build is identified by the token recorded below.

session token of kawif-fawig = htk31_f3f599be2b1a34affb1efa8d0feccf8

## Ticket: Config drift on Gridwright generator

Severity: medium. The crossword generator on prod-east produces easier puzzles than prod-west. Root cause appears to be drift: a hotfix during the Marlowe outage changed word-list weighting and fill timeouts on east only, never backported. Symmetry enforcement also differs. Support should route puzzle-quality complaints here rather than opening new tickets until remediation lands. To verify whether a node has drifted, compare its runtime settings against the canonical configuration values below.

deployment values, yadug-bawif:
[framir]
team = pelox
access_code = ac_a38ab2
owner = tamion.julael
host = framir.tolvaqlabs.test
port = 11211
peer = tammir.zemvargrid.local
salt = 2215ef03
pin = 1541

Subject: DR drill notes — dependency pinning

Team, quick recap before the weekly sync. During Thursday's disaster-recovery drill, the Foxmere rebuild stalled because two transitive dependencies weren't pinned, so the cold-start image drifted. New policy: all lockfiles are authoritative and rebuilds pull from the sealed mirror. Restoring the sealed mirror during a drill requires the recovery passphrase below.

unlock words, bawip-taduf: casix-belael-norael-silwyn